(Enter summary)
Abstract: M
icrokernel technology is a well recognised technology for building operating systems.
Recently there has been some experimentation in the area of building distributed
object-support platforms on top of microkernels. This thesis presents the design of the
core kernel components of such a platform. These kernel components form the nucleus
of this platform. The nucleus is designed to be an extensible minimal support layer for
distributed object-support run-time systems. The platform is being... (Update)
Active bibliography (related documents): More All
0.6: Implementing the Comandos Virtual Machine - Cahill, Taylor, Starovic.. (1993)
(Correct)
0.6: A Survey of Multiprocessor Operating System Kernels - Mukherjee, Schwan, Gopinath (1993)
(Correct)
0.5: E**: Porting the E Database Language to Amadeus - McEvoy (1994)
(Correct)
Similar documents based on text: More All
0.4: Extensible Systems - The Tigger Approach - Cahill, Hogan, Judge, O'Grady.. (1994)
(Correct)
0.3: Tigger Project - Raising The
(Correct)
0.2: An Architecture for Community Support Platforms - Modularization.. - Koch (2002)
(Correct)
BibTeX entry: (Update)
@mastersthesis{ hogan94tigger,
author = "Christine Hogan",
title = "The {Tigger Cub Nucleus}",
year = "1994",
url = "citeseer.ist.psu.edu/hogan94tigger.html" }
Citations (may not include all citations):
444
Mach: A New Kernel Foundation for Unix Development (context) - Accetta, Brown et al. - 1986
423
End-to-end Arguments in System Design
- Saltzer, Reed et al. - 1984
373
Unix Network Programming (context) - Stevens - 1990
226
Lightweight Remote Procedure Call (context) - Bershad, Anderson et al. - 1990
210
The Amber System: Parallel Programming on a Network of Multi..
- Chase, Amador et al. - 1989
141
Presto: A System for Object-Oriented Parallel Programming (context) - Bershad, Lazowska et al. - 1988
127
Protocol Service Decomposition for HighPerformance Networkin..
- Maeda, Bershad - 1993
123
Improving Round Trip Time Estimates in Reliable Transport Pr..
- Karn, Partridge - 1991
123
Structure and Encapsulation in Distributed Systems: the Prox..
- Shapiro - 1986
115
The Spring nucleus: A microkernel for objects
- Hamilton, Kougiouris - 1993
112
The Clouds Distributed Operating System (context) - Dasgupta, LeBlanc et al. - 1991
105
The Duality of Memory and Communication in the Implementatio..
- Young, Tevanian et al. - 1987
102
Scheduling Support for Concurrency and Parallelism in the Ma..
- Black - 1990
100
Using Continuations to Implement Thread Management and Commu..
- Draves, Bershad et al. - 1991
83
An Architectural Overview of QNX (context) - Hildebrand - 1992
72
Distributed Operating Systems: The Logical Design (context) - Goscinski - 1991
65
Object Distribution in Orca using Compile-Time and Run-Time ..
- Bal, Kaashoek - 1993
59
The Design and Implementation of the Clouds Distributed Oper..
- Dasgupta, Chen et al. - 1990
55
Distributed Operating Systems (context) - Tanenbaum, Van Renesse - 1985
55
Architectural Support for Single Address Space Operating Sys..
- Koldinger, Chase et al. - 1992
53
Generic Virtual Memory Management for Operating Systems Kern..
- Abrossimov, Rozier et al. - 1989
50
COOL: Kernel Support for Object-Oriented Environments
- Habert, Mosseri - 1990
41
Experiences with the Amoeba Distributed Operating System
- Tanenbaum, van Renesse et al. - 1990
39
A Fast Mach Network IPC Implementation
- Joseph - 1992
35
Lightweight Shared Objects in a 64-bit Operating System
- Chase, Levy et al. - 1992
33
An Implementation of Unix on an ObjectOriented Operating Sys..
- Khalidi, Nelson - 1993
32
Transparent Fault-tolerance in Parallel Orca Programs
- Kaashoek, Michiels et al. - 1992
29
The COMANDOS Distributed Application Platform
- Cahill, Balter et al. - 1993
28
Class Hierarchical Open Interface for Custom Embedded System.. (context) - Campbell, Johnston et al. - 1987
26
The Checkpoint Mechanism in KeyKOS (context) - Landau - 1992
26
A Distributed Implementation of the Shared Data-Object Model
- Bal, Kaashoek et al. - 1989
26
The Increasing Irrelevance of IPC Performance for Microkerne..
- Bershad - 1992
25
Medusa: An Experiment in Distributed Operating System Struct.. (context) - Ousterhout, Scelza et al. - 1980
24
FLIP: An Internetwork Protocol for Supporting Distributed Sy.. (context) - Kaashoek, Van Renesse et al. - 1993
23
Networking Performance for Microkernels
- Maeda, Bershad - 1992
22
The Spring Virtual Memory System
- Khalidi, Nelson - 1993
22
The KeyKOS Nanokernel Architecture (context) - Bomberger, Frantz et al. - 1992
20
Distributed Programming with Objects and Threads in the Clou.. (context) - Dasgupta, Ananthanarayanan et al. - 1991
20
Operating Systems Review (context) - Hardy, Architecture - 1985
19
The Amoeba Distributed Operating System --- A Status Report
- Tanenbaum, Kaashoek et al. - 1991
18
A Fast and General Implementation of Mach IPC in a Network
- Orman, O'Malley et al. - 1993
17
Extending the Operating System to Support an Object-Oriented.. (context) - Marques, Guedes - 1989
16
Computer Science Department (context) - Cooper, Draves et al. - 1988
16
Department of Computer Science (context) - Taylor, Amadeus - 1993
15
Extending a Capability Based System into a Network Environme.. (context) - Sansom, Julin et al. - 1986
13
Guide: An Implementation of the COMANDOS Object Oriented Arc.. (context) - Decouchant, Duda et al. - 1988
13
COOL-2: An Object-oriented Support Platform Built Above The ..
- Lea, Amaral et al. - 1991
13
Choices: The design of a multiprocessor operating system (context) - Campbell, Russo et al. - 1987
13
Experiments with RealTime Servers in Real-Time Mach
- Nakajima, Kitayama et al. - 1993
13
The Chorus Distributed Operating System: Some Design Issues (context) - Rozier, Legatheaux-Martins - 1987
12
Object Memory and Storage Management in the Clouds Kernel (context) - Pitts, Dasgupta - 1988
10
Fast Causal Multicast (context) - Birman, Schiper et al. - 1990
10
Transparent Object Migration in COOL
- Amaral, Jacquemot et al. - 1992
9
Is the Microkernel Technology well suited for the Support of..
- Balter, Chevalier et al. - 1993
9
Efficient Reliable Group Communication for Distributed Syste..
- Kaashoek, Tanenbaum - 1994
9
Experiences Building an Object-Oriented System in C (context) - Madany, Campbell et al. - 1991
8
Object Oriented Transaction Processing in the KeyKOS Microke..
- Frantz, Landau - 1993
7
Supporting the Amadeus Platform on UNIX (context) - Cahill, Taylor et al. - 1992
7
Supporting an Object-Oriented Distributed System: Experience..
- Boyer, Cayuela et al. - 1990
7
Process Management and Exception Handling in Multiprocessor .. (context) - Russo, Johnston et al. - 1988
7
Basic concepts for the support of distributed systems: the c.. (context) - Zimmermann, Banino et al. - 1981
7
languages for distribution and persistence (context) - Cahill, Horn et al. - 1990
6
Real-Time Mach Timers: Exporting Time to the User
- Savage, Tokuda - 1993
6
MIKE: A distributed object-oriented programming platform on ..
- Castro, Neves et al. - 1993
6
Experience Building a File System on a Highly Modular Operat..
- Nelson, Khalidi et al. - 1993
6
Overview of the Amadeus Project (context) - Group - 1992
5
Real-time Extensions for Mach (context) - Nakajima, Yazaki et al. - 1992
5
an Object-Oriented Operating System (context) - Campbell, Madany et al. - 1990
5
Organizing and Typing Persistent Objects Within an Object-Or.. (context) - Madany, Campbell - 1992
5
Generic runtime support for distributed persistent programmi.. (context) - Cahill, Baker et al. - 1993
4
Short Overview of Amoeba (context) - van Renesse, Tanenbaum - 1992
4
An Object-Oriented Approach Towards a General Model of File .. (context) - Madany - 1990
4
Sun Microsystems Laboratories (context) - Radia, Nelson et al. - 1993
4
Sun Microsystems Laboratories (context) - Nelson, Khalidi et al. - 1993
4
A Model For Persistent Shared Memory Addressing in Distribut..
- Amaral, Lea et al. - 1992
3
Distributed Systems Group (context) - Cahill, in et al. - 1993
3
Distributed Systems Group (context) - Cahill, -- et al. - 1994
3
Distributed Systems Group (context) - Cahill, Tigger et al. - 1994
3
A Flexible External Pager Interface (context) - Khalidi, Nelson - 1993
3
The Roscoe Distributed Operating System (context) - Solomon, Finkel - 1989
3
Technical Report COMANDOS-INESC-TR (context) - Sousa, Ferreira et al. - 1990
3
Distributed Systems Group (context) - Taylor, Tracing et al. - 1993
3
Distributed Systems Group (context) - Taylor, Facility et al. - 1993
3
Distributed Systems Group (context) - Taylor, in et al. - 1993
2
OISIN: Operating System Support for Objects in a Distributed..
- Cahill, Kramer - 1991
2
A Survey of Multiprocessor Operating System Kernels (context) - Mukherjee, Schwan et al. - 1993
2
Sharing Objects in a Distributed System
- Judge, Cahill - 1993
1
Presented in the CaberNet Plenary Workshop (context) - Cahill, Hogan et al. - 1994
1
The Generic Runtime Interface (context) - Cahill, Sheppard et al. - 1991
1
A Functional Comparison of the Chorus v (context) - Systemes - 1990
1
Runtime options for resolving object references (context) - Taylor - 1993
1
Server Library Interfaces (context) - Loepere, MK - 1993
1
Data Persistence in Programming Languages: A Survey
- Clamen - 1991
1
High-Performance Persistent Store for the Amadeus Distribute.. (context) - O'Grady - 1994
1
Tracing in Tigger --- The User Interface (context) - Taylor - 1993
1
Object-Oriented Microkernel Interface (context) - Finlayson, Hannecke et al. - 1993
1
Distributed Systems Group (context) - Hogan, IPC et al. - 1993
1
Multiple Language Support (context) - Kramer - 1990
1
The Tigger threads package for PC -- architectural outline (context) - Zimmermann - 1994
Documents on the same site (http://www.acm.uiuc.edu/white_papers/incoming/TCD/): More
Some Issues in Load Balancing in Amadeus - Tangney, Condon (1992)
(Correct)
Interfacing a Language to the Comandos Virtual Machine - Colm Mchugh (1993)
(Correct)
Extensible Systems - The Tigger Approach - Cahill, Hogan, Judge, O'Grady.. (1994)
(Correct)
Online articles have much greater impact More about CiteSeer.IST Add search form to your site Submit documents Feedback
CiteSeer.IST - Copyright Penn State and NEC